Show This week thieves have been plying their avocation by stealing a watch out of the housa of C. A. Terry; a suit of underwear from the clothesline at C. Seggmiller's; an undershirt, a pair of drawers, a pair of men's socks, and a blanket from the clothesline of Arthur Miles. As yet the culprits have not been caught and it is not known wheth- er ilia thieves are residents or tramps, but care should be taken so as not to give such hucksters an opportunity to pilfer. In some parts, every tramp in the country would have been arrested on suspicion under such circumstances, and when proven innocent would then have been "turned loose and told to "skip " |
